Chinese Vice-Premier meets former US diplomat

China is willing to work with the United States to implement the important consensus reached by the two heads of state at their meeting in San Francisco, promoting mutually beneficial cooperation in various fields of the economy and trade, and pushing bilateral relations in a sound, stable and sustainable direction, said a senior government official.

During his meeting with Richard Haass, former president of the United States' Council on Foreign Relations, on Monday in Beijing, Chinese Vice-Premier He Lifeng said China will advance its opening-up steadfastly and at a high level, and enhance its liberalization and facilitation of trade and investment.

Also a member of the Political Bureau of the Communist Party of China Central Committee, he said that China welcomes companies from all over the world, including the US firms, to continue to invest and conduct business in China.

During the meeting, the two sides exchanged views on Sino-US relations, economic and trade cooperation, and other topics.
